Description

【考案の詳細な説明】[Detailed description of the invention]

【0001】[0001]

【考案の属する技術分野】[Technical field to which the invention belongs]

本考案は包袋や薬袋等の封筒に係り、詳しくは嵩むらを少なくした封筒に関す るものである。 The present invention relates to envelopes such as envelopes and medicine bags, and more particularly to envelopes with reduced bulkiness.

【0002】[0002]

【従来の技術】[Prior art]

例えば薬袋等の封筒では、処方表示等をパーソナルコンピュータ等のプリンタ ーで患者個々に印字するが、この場合、通常の封筒であると糊代部分の嵩が高い ことから、ピンチローラの送り速度が左右でばらついたりして、特にマガジンタ イプのインサーターでは上記プリンターに対して普通の紙のようにはスムーズな 給紙が行いにくいという問題がある。 For example, in the case of envelopes such as medicine bags, prescription indications and the like are printed on individual patients by a printer such as a personal computer.In this case, the feed rate of the pinch roller is increased due to the large bulk of the margin for ordinary envelopes. There is a problem that the paper may fluctuate between the left and right, and especially in a magazine type inserter, it is difficult to feed the printer smoothly as with ordinary paper.

【0003】 このため、上記糊代による嵩むらをなくし、プリンターの給紙マガジンに定量 を挿入しうる封筒もある。 このような封筒は従来、重ね合せた2枚の紙を三方、四方糊付けすることによ って作成するが、このような方法では封筒の両面に印刷をしておく場合、上記の ように2枚の紙を用いるために印刷用版が2枚、印刷も2回必要となり、このこ とから前記通常の封筒に比べると製造原価が高くなるという問題を招来する。[0003] Therefore, there is also an envelope that eliminates the bulk unevenness due to the above-mentioned adhesive margin and allows a fixed amount to be inserted into a paper feed magazine of a printer. Conventionally, such an envelope is created by gluing two sheets of paper that are superimposed on each other in a three- or four-sided manner. The use of two sheets of paper requires two printing plates and two printings, which causes a problem that the production cost is higher than that of the ordinary envelope.

【0004】[0004]

【考案が解決しようとする課題】[Problems to be solved by the invention]

本考案は叙上の如き実状に対処し、1枚の紙を2つ折り等すると共に、その周 囲を接着することにより、封筒の嵩むらを少なくしてプリンターへの給紙を円滑 に行わしめると共に、両面印刷を施す場合でも一版一刷で行わしめてコストの低 減を図ることを目的とするものである。 The present invention addresses the situation described above, folds one sheet of paper into two, and glues the area around it to reduce the unevenness of the envelope and facilitate the paper feeding to the printer. At the same time, it is intended to reduce costs by performing double-sided printing with one plate and one printing.

【0005】[0005]

【課題を解決するための手段】[Means for Solving the Problems]

すなわち、上記目的に適合する本考案の封筒は、紙をほぼ2つに折り重ねて袋 体を形成する封筒であって、2つ折り片の一方を他方より長くして紙を2つ折り にすると共に、この長い2つ折り片の先端部を折り返して短い2つ折り片の先端 部に突き合わせ、これら2つ折り部および折り返し部の各内側と、上記2つ折り 片の両側の合せ部とを夫々接着剤により接着したことを特徴とする。 そして、熱溶融性接着剤を用いる場合には、事前に塗布して折り工程の後に熱 プレス等によって接着を行うようにする。 That is, the envelope of the present invention that meets the above-mentioned object is an envelope in which paper is folded almost in two to form a bag. One of the two folded pieces is longer than the other, and the paper is folded in two. Then, the tip of the long folded piece is folded back and abutted against the tip of the short folded piece, and the inside of each of the folded portion and the folded portion and the mating portion on both sides of the folded piece are bonded with an adhesive. It is characterized by having done. When a hot-melt adhesive is used, the adhesive is applied in advance, and after the folding step, bonding is performed by a hot press or the like.

【0006】[0006]

【作用】[Action]

上記本考案の封筒では、全周において接着剤が塗布され紙が接着されることか らこの四周において封筒の嵩むらが少なくなり、これによりプリンターへの給紙 を円滑に行わしめることが可能である。 そして、上記封筒は1枚の紙を折ることによって形成されることから、予め封 筒の表裏に印刷を要する場合はこの紙を折る前の時点で行うことにより一版一刷 で低コストで印刷を行うことが可能である。 In the envelope of the present invention, since the adhesive is applied and the paper is adhered all around, the unevenness of the envelope is reduced in these four rounds, thereby making it possible to feed the paper to the printer smoothly. is there. Since the envelope is formed by folding one sheet of paper, if it is necessary to print on the front and back of the envelope in advance, printing is performed before folding the paper, so that printing can be performed at a low cost with one printing and one printing. It is possible to do.

【0007】[0007]

【考案の実施の形態】[Embodiment of the invention]

以下さらに添付図面を参照して、本考案の実施の形態を説明する。 Hereinafter, embodiments of the present invention will be described with reference to the accompanying drawings.

【0008】 図1は本考案実施形態の封筒の糊付け状態を示す裏面から見た透視図、図2は 同封筒の内側を示す展開図、図3は同、外側を示す展開図、図4は同封筒の表面 図、図5は同、裏面図である。FIG. 1 is a perspective view showing the glued state of the envelope according to the embodiment of the present invention viewed from the back, FIG. 2 is a developed view showing the inside of the envelope, FIG. 3 is a developed view showing the same and the outside, and FIG. FIG. 5 is a back view of the same envelope.

【0009】 上記実施形態の封筒は、図1〜図3に示すように、紙1を折り目2にて2つに 折り重ねて四角形の袋体の外形を概ね形成する。 この場合、上記折り目2を境とする2つ折り片の一方3を他方4より長くして 紙1を2つ折りすると共に、この長い方の2つ折り片3の先端部3aを折り目5 で折り返して、短い方の2つ折り片4の先端部4aに突き合せ、そして、これら 2つ折り部6及び折り返し部7の各内側と、上記2つ折り片3、4の両側の合せ 部8、9とに夫々熱圧着接着糊10(酢酸ビニル系ヒートシール糊)を塗布して 接着している。In the envelope of the above embodiment, as shown in FIGS. 1 to 3, the paper 1 is folded in two at the fold line 2 to substantially form the outer shape of the rectangular bag. In this case, the paper 1 is folded in two by making one of the two folds 3 from the fold 2 longer than the other 4, and the leading end 3a of the longer two folds 3 is folded back at the fold 5, Abutting against the distal end portion 4a of the shorter two-folded piece 4, and heat is applied to the inside of each of the two-folded part 6 and the folded-back part 7 and the mating parts 8 and 9 on both sides of the two-folded pieces 3 and 4, respectively. A pressure bonding adhesive 10 (vinyl acetate heat seal adhesive) is applied and adhered.

【0010】 封筒の開口11は、図5に示すように封筒裏面の、前記長短の2つ折り片3、 4の突き合せ部に形成されており、この実施形態では上記1対の2つ折り片3、 4は重なり合うことなく突き合っている。 なお、上記熱圧着接着糊10は常温では液状であり、封筒の被接着部両面に塗 布したのち乾燥され、その後これら被接着部両面を重合して熱圧着することによ り接着される。As shown in FIG. 5, the opening 11 of the envelope is formed at the butting portion of the long and short two-fold pieces 3 and 4 on the back surface of the envelope. In this embodiment, the pair of two-fold pieces 3 , 4 are facing each other without overlapping. The thermocompression bonding adhesive 10 is liquid at room temperature, applied on both sides of the bonded portion of the envelope, dried, and then bonded by polymerizing and thermocompressing both surfaces of the bonded portion.

【0011】 一方、図6は上記実施形態の封筒を製造する装置を示す側面図であり、巻取原 紙12から引き出された紙1は、印刷ユニット13で印刷を施され、UV乾燥機 14を経て糊塗布機15へ行き、高周波乾燥機16で一旦糊を乾された後、折条 機17で上記のように折られると共に、熱圧着機18で上記糊の接着が行われる 。 そして、カット部19で裁断され、排紙部20へ製品として送られる。 なお、図7に示すように、上記折条機17では、幅型21を中心として、前記 折り目2を境とした2つ折りと、前記折り目5を境とした紙1の長手方向に連続 的に行われる。On the other hand, FIG. 6 is a side view showing an apparatus for manufacturing the envelope of the above embodiment. The paper 1 pulled out from the winding base paper 12 is printed by a printing unit 13 and is subjected to a UV dryer 14. After that, the paste is once dried by the high frequency dryer 16 and then folded by the folding machine 17 as described above, and the glue is bonded by the thermocompression bonding machine 18. Then, the sheet is cut by the cutting unit 19 and sent to the sheet discharging unit 20 as a product. As shown in FIG. 7, in the folding machine 17, the folding machine 17 is continuously folded in the longitudinal direction of the paper 1 around the fold line 2 and the fold line 5 around the width mold 21. Done.

【0012】 このように折られた紙1は、同図に示すように筒状をなして次の熱圧着機へ送 られ、ここで熱プレスを受けて前記塗布した熱圧接着剤10を接着させる。この 接着剤は前記の如く封筒単位で必要箇所に塗布されているため、この時点で封筒 の接着は完了し、その後封筒の大きさに裁断されて最終製品となる。The folded paper 1 is sent to the next thermocompression bonding machine in the form of a cylinder as shown in the figure, where it is subjected to hot pressing to bond the applied hot-press adhesive 10. Let it. Since the adhesive is applied to the necessary places in units of envelopes as described above, the bonding of the envelopes is completed at this time, and thereafter, the envelopes are cut into the size of the envelopes to obtain the final product.

【0013】 しかして、上記本考案実施形態の封筒では、全周において接着剤が塗布され紙 が接着されることから、この四周において封筒の嵩むらが少なくなり、これによ りプリンターへの給紙を円滑に行えると共に、封筒は1枚の紙を折ることによっ て形成されることから、予め表裏に印刷を施す場合でもこの紙を折る前の時点で 施すことにより一版一刷で低コストにて印刷を行うことが可能である。However, in the envelope according to the embodiment of the present invention, since the adhesive is applied to the entire periphery and the paper is adhered to the envelope, the unevenness of the envelope is reduced in the four periphery, thereby supplying the envelope to the printer. The envelope can be formed by folding one sheet of paper, and the envelope can be formed smoothly by folding one sheet of paper. Printing can be performed at a cost.
